VISUAL BASIC Вычислить значение заданной функции. Осуществить вывод значений аргумента и результатов вычислений значений функции в заданном диапазоне с заданным шагом:
Sub Main() Dim i As Integer Dim x As Double Dim y As Double Dim rangeStart As Integer Dim rangeEnd As Integer Dim stepSize As Double
rangeStart = 0 rangeEnd = 10 stepSize = 1 For i = rangeStart To rangeEnd Step stepSize x = i y = CalculateFunction(x) MsgBox "Значение аргумента: " & x & vbCrLf & "Результат: " & y Next i
End Sub
Function CalculateFunction(ByVal x As Double) As Double CalculateFunction = x ^ 2 + 2 * x + 3 'Укажите нужную вам функцию здесь End Function
Option Explicit
Sub Main()
rangeStart = 0Dim i As Integer
Dim x As Double
Dim y As Double
Dim rangeStart As Integer
Dim rangeEnd As Integer
Dim stepSize As Double
rangeEnd = 10
stepSize = 1
For i = rangeStart To rangeEnd Step stepSize
x = i
y = CalculateFunction(x)
MsgBox "Значение аргумента: " & x & vbCrLf & "Результат: " & y
Next i
End Sub
Function CalculateFunction(ByVal x As Double) As Double
CalculateFunction = x ^ 2 + 2 * x + 3 'Укажите нужную вам функцию здесь
End Function